The Spring Adult Theatre Education Classes will offer four options, including Audition Techniques, Beginning Tap, Musical Theatre, and Production. With experienced and talented instructors, participants will receive top-notch instruction in a fun and supportive environment.
Audition Techniques will help students stand out at auditions and improve their chances of landing a role. Beginning Tap will have students tapping their way to the top while gaining valuable experience in rhythm and movement. Musical Theatre classes will teach students how to sing and act while performing popular Broadway hits. Production classes will cover all aspects of production, from set design to lighting and stage management.
No experience is required for any of these classes.
